Quick answer

Kadiripuram is a village in Pappireddipatti Taluk of Dharmapuri district in Tamil Nadu. Its Census location code is 643522.

About Kadiripuram village record

Use this page to check the source record for Kadiripuram, including its village code and its place within Pappireddipatti Taluk and Dharmapuri district.

The Census 2011 record reports population 1,305, 363 households, area 308.85 hectares, PIN code 636905.

Facilities and amenities in Kadiripuram

The Census 2011 village directory reports the following education, health, water, transport, communication and public-service facilities. These are historical records, not a statement of current availability.

Census 2011 facilities reported for Kadiripuram
Facility categoryFacility or serviceCensus 2011 status
EducationGovernment primary schoolAvailable in village; 1 reported
EducationGovernment middle schoolAvailable in village; 1 reported
EducationGovernment sec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
EducationGovernment senior sec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
HealthCommunity health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health sub-centre0 reported
HealthAllopathic hospital0 reported
HealthDispensary0 reported
HealthVeterinary hospital0 reported
Water and sanitationTreated tap waterNot available in village
Water and sanitationUntreated tap waterAvailable in village
Water and sanitationTotal sanitation campaign coverageNot available in village
Water and sanitationCommunity toilet complexNot available in village
CommunicationPost officeN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
CommunicationSub post officeN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
CommunicationMobile phone coverageAvailable in village
CommunicationInternet / CSCN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
Transport and roadsPublic b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sPrivate b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sRailway stationN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
Transport and roadsPucca roadAvailable in village
Transport and roadsAll-weather roadA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esATMNot available in village
Banking and public servicesCommercial bankN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
Banking and public servicesCooperative bankNot available in village; nearest facility 5 to 10 km away
Banking and public servicesPDS shopA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esAnganwadi centreA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esASHA workerAvailable in village
PowerDomestic power supplyAvailable in village; 3 hours/day
PowerAgriculture power supplyAvailable in village; 3 hours/day
PowerPower supply for all usersAvailable in village; 3 hours/day
Land-use details reported for Kadiripuram
Land-use fieldCensus 2011 value
Non-agricultural use area52.64 hectares
Current fallow land57.19 hectares
Net area sown171.48 hectares
Total unirrigated land67.96 hectares
Irrigated area103.52 hectares
Wells / tube-wells irrigated area103.52 hectares
